What is Microneedling?

A microneedling facial, also known as collagen induction therapy, is a skincare treatment that uses a device equipped with fine needles to create tiny punctures in the skin.

These micro-injuries stimulate the body’s natural wound-healing process, promoting collagen and elastin production, which can improve skin texture and firmness.

Key steps in a microneedling facial include:

  • Cleansing: Removing impurities and preparing the skin.
  • Application of Numbing Cream: To minimize discomfort during the procedure.
  • Microneedling: Using a specialized device to create controlled micro-injuries in the skin.
  • Application of Serums: Applying serums or other treatments to enhance absorption and benefit from the increased skin permeability.
  • Post-Treatment Care: Applying moisturizers and sun protection to aid healing and protect the skin.

Microneedling can help reduce fine lines, acne scars, and stretch marks, and improve overall skin texture and tone.
